The cleanest LeBron trade, to me, would be with the Knicks.
The Lakers need wings and bigs. Mikal Bridges, Josh Hart and Mitchell Robinson all have two or fewer years left on their deals. They’d all fit on a Luka-centric roster (though Hart’s shooting would hurt). – 5:05 PM

Free agent center Luka Garza has agreed to a two-year, $5.5 million fully guaranteed deal with the Boston Celtics, sources tell ESPN. The Celtics negotiated the new deal with Garza’s representatives Mark Bartelstein and Kieran Piller of @PrioritySports tonight. pic.x.com/d5x5HzGYIL – 8:04 PM
